Product Overview

The Allen-Bradley 1762-OB8 is a solid-state expansion module from the MicroLogix 1200 series. It adds 8 digital DC sourcing outputs to your control system. Each output supports 24V DC at 0.5A with an aggregate of 4A per module. The operating voltage range is 20.4 to 26.4V DC. This module draws 115 mA from the 5V backplane and delivers fast signal response with an ON-state delay of only 0.1 ms and an OFF-state delay of 1.0 ms. The 1762-OB8 features group-to-backplane isolation tested at 1200V AC or 1697V DC for one second. It operates at 0 to 55°C and withstands 30G shock and 5G vibration at 500 Hz. Compact dimensions (90 x 87 x 40.4 mm) and a weight of 210 g make it easy to integrate into existing DIN rail cabinets.

Technical Specifications

  • Number of outputs: 8 (sourcing)
  • Operating voltage: 20.4-26.4V DC
  • Voltage category: 24V DC
  • Output current per point: 0.5A maximum
  • Aggregate current: 4A per module
  • Surge current: 2A for 10 ms, repeatable every 2 s
  • ON-state voltage drop: 1.0V DC maximum
  • Off-state leakage current: 1.0 mA maximum
  • Signal delay (ON): 0.1 ms resistive load
  • Signal delay (OFF): 1.0 ms resistive load
  • Backplane current: 115 mA at 5V DC
  • Power dissipation: 1.6 W
  • Isolation (group to backplane): 1200V AC or 1697V DC for 1 s
  • Power supply distance: up to 6 module lengths
  • Operating temperature: 0 to 55°C (32 to 131°F)
  • Storage temperature: -40 to 85°C (-40 to 185°F)
  • Humidity: 5 to 95% non-condensing
  • Altitude: 2000 m (6561 ft) maximum
  • Shock: 30G
  • Vibration: 5G at 500 Hz
  • Mounting: DIN rail
  • Certifications: UL, c-UL, CE

Installation & Maintenance Guide

Mount the 1762-OB8 on a standard DIN rail next to the MicroLogix 1200 controller or other expansion modules. Ensure the backplane connector aligns properly and the module snaps into place. Use a 24V DC power supply with adequate capacity for all outputs. Wire each output terminal to the load, observing correct polarity for sourcing outputs. Maintain clearance for airflow and avoid exceeding the 55°C ambient temperature. Periodically check terminal connections for tightness and inspect for dust or moisture. Replace the module immediately if output failure or physical damage occurs. Always disconnect power before servicing.

Rockwell Automation 1762-OB8 FAQ

Q1: Is the 1762-OB8 compatible with older MicroLogix 1000 controllers?

The 1762-OB8 is designed for the MicroLogix 1200 expansion I/O bus. It does not physically or electrically fit MicroLogix 1000 or other platforms. Use only with MicroLogix 1200 controllers.

Q2: What is the maximum current per output and total per module?

Each output can handle up to 0.5A continuous. The total aggregate current across all eight outputs must not exceed 4A per module. Short-term surges up to 2A for 10 ms are allowed.

Q4: What is the power supply distance limitation?

The module supports up to six module lengths of power supply distance from the controller or power supply source. Beyond that, voltage drop may affect performance. Use the recommended spacing for reliable operation.

Q5: Can this module operate in high humidity or condensing environments?

The 1762-OB8 is rated for 5 to 95% non-condensing relative humidity. Do not expose to condensation. If moisture is likely, install the module in a sealed enclosure with appropriate environmental controls.
